Is Container RNG safe for kids?
Roblox publishes a content rating for every experience, based on a questionnaire its developer must complete. This is Container RNG's, unedited.
- • Suitable for everyone Roblox found nothing in this game that needs a content warning.
- Multiplayer
- Up to 6 players per server, so your child plays alongside strangers.
- In-game purchases
- Like nearly every Roblox experience, items and perks are sold for Robux. A spending PIN in Roblox account settings blocks surprise purchases.
Chat, friend requests, and spending are controlled in Roblox account settings, not per game. Ratings come from Roblox's experience guidelines API and refresh automatically.
